10 Types of Employee Training Programs and Pro Tips for Success

A strong training program can make the difference between a workforce that simply functions and one that thrives. This guide outlines the 10 most essential types of employee training programs and gives you actionable tips for building effective, modern learning experiences that deliver real results.

 

What Is an Employee Training Program? 

 

An employee training program is a structured system of activities, methods, and resources designed to systematically enhance an organization’s workforce’s skills, knowledge, and capabilities, leading to improved job performance, better productivity, and alignment with company goals. These programs are strategic investments that can address skill gaps, support career development, foster a culture of continuous learning, and provide a competitive edge.

Training can be delivered in different formats, such as classroom sessions, online modules, workshops, or on-the-job learning. The goal is to close skill gaps, improve productivity, and prepare employees for current and future responsibilities.

Training programs provide major advantages for both organizations and employees:

  • Improved performance: Employees who understand their tasks and tools can be more productive and creative in their roles.
  • Consistency in processes: Standardized training ensures that everyone follows the same methods, reducing variability and errors.
  • Adaptability to change: Training helps workers adopt new technologies, workflows, or regulations more quickly.
  • Employee retention: Investing in learning shows commitment to staff growth, which can increase engagement and reduce turnover.
  • Stronger leadership pipeline: Programs that focus on management skills prepare high-potential employees for leadership roles.

 

This is part of a series of articles about virtual classroom

 

Key Types and Examples of Employee Training Programs 

 

1. Orientation and Onboarding

This type of training helps new hires understand company policies, culture, and workflows. It covers basics such as workplace expectations, communication channels, and introductions to team members and tools. A well-structured onboarding reduces the time it takes for employees to become productive and lowers early turnover.

Examples of orientation and onboarding training:

  • A two-week onboarding program for new hires that includes interactive tours of departments, hands-on systems training, and sessions with company leaders.
  • An onboarding portal with short videos covering policies, benefits enrollment, and an introduction to company values.
  • A buddy system where new employees are paired with experienced staff for their first 30 days to accelerate cultural integration.

 

2. Compliance and Safety Training

Compliance training ensures employees follow laws, regulations, and internal policies. Examples include anti-harassment training, data protection practices, or industry-specific standards. Safety training addresses workplace hazards, emergency procedures, and equipment use, critical in industries like construction, manufacturing, and healthcare.

Examples of compliance and safety training:

  • An annual mandatory cybersecurity awareness course covering phishing, password hygiene, and data handling protocols.
  • OSHA-compliant safety workshops for warehouse staff focused on forklift operation, PPE use, and incident reporting procedures.
  • A healthcare compliance program covering HIPAA rules and ethical patient communication for clinical staff.

 

3. Technical and Product Training

This type focuses on job-specific skills and product knowledge. For example, IT staff may learn new programming frameworks, while sales teams receive training on product features and updates. The aim is to keep employees proficient with tools and processes that directly affect performance.

Examples of technical and product training:

  • A monthly coding bootcamp for backend developers to learn and practice microservices architecture.
  • Product training workshops for customer support agents on new software features ahead of quarterly releases.
  • CRM certification courses for sales teams to master pipeline management and lead scoring.

 

4. Leadership and Management Training

Programs in this category prepare employees for supervisory or executive roles. They typically cover decision-making, conflict resolution, coaching, and strategic thinking. Strong leadership training builds a pipeline of capable managers who can guide teams effectively.

Examples of leadership and management training:

  • A six-month emerging leaders program covering feedback, delegation, and performance coaching.
  • A simulation-based executive decision-making course for senior managers focused on crisis response.
  • A cross-functional leadership lab where team leads manage mock projects and receive peer evaluations.

 

5. Soft Skills and Team Training

Soft skills training develops abilities such as communication, problem-solving, and collaboration. Team training may include workshops on feedback, project coordination, or negotiation. These skills help employees work better together and maintain strong client relationships.

Examples of soft skills and team training:

  • A communication skills workshop using role-play to practice giving and receiving constructive feedback.
  • Conflict resolution training for cross-departmental teams working on shared initiatives.
  • A virtual collaboration series teaching remote teams to align expectations, manage time zones, and track progress effectively.

 

6. Diversity, Equity, and Inclusion Training

DEI training helps employees recognize and address bias, improve cultural awareness, and build inclusive workplaces. Programs may focus on respectful communication, equitable hiring practices, or accessibility considerations. The goal is to create an environment where diverse perspectives are valued.

Examples of DEI training:

  • Monthly interactive webinars on unconscious bias with real-world case studies and reflection exercises.
  • A DEI certification track for managers that includes inclusive hiring, accessibility best practices, and leading diverse teams.
  • Story-sharing sessions where employees from different backgrounds discuss experiences to build empathy and awareness.

 

7. Upskilling and Reskilling

Upskilling expands current skills to meet evolving job demands, while reskilling prepares employees for entirely new roles. This is common during digital transformations or organizational restructuring. Companies benefit by retaining workers instead of replacing them when skill needs shift.

Examples of upskilling/reskilling training:

  • A data analytics upskilling path for marketing employees, including Excel modeling, SQL basics, and dashboard design.
  • A reskilling program to transition call center agents into chatbot training and support roles during automation rollout.
  • A digital literacy series for manufacturing staff covering basic IT use, cybersecurity basics, and enterprise software navigation.

 

8. Tuition Assistance and Education Programs

Some organizations support long-term employee development by covering costs for external education, such as college degrees, certifications, or specialized courses. These programs encourage continuous learning and help employees bring new expertise back to the workplace.

Examples of tuition assistance and education support:

  • A tuition reimbursement plan that covers 80% of costs for accredited undergraduate or graduate courses related to the employee’s role.
  • Company-sponsored certification programs in project management, HR, or cloud technologies.
  • A learning stipend for employees to take approved external courses on Coursera or edX.

 

9. Arts-Based and Creative Training

Creative training uses methods from arts, such as theater, music, or design, to improve skills like innovation, empathy, and adaptability. These sessions often take employees outside of routine work contexts, encouraging fresh thinking and problem-solving approaches.

Examples of creative training:

  • Improvisational theater workshops designed to improve adaptability, quick thinking, and collaboration under pressure.
  • Visual storytelling sessions for marketing teams to explore creative ways to present data and campaign narratives.
  • Music-based group activities to enhance listening, rhythm in communication, and team coordination.

 

10. Cross-Training and Job Rotation

Cross-training teaches employees to perform tasks outside their primary role, while job rotation moves them through different positions within the company. Both approaches increase workforce flexibility, reduce dependency on single individuals, and give employees a broader understanding of operations.

Examples of cross-training:

  • A six-month job rotation program allowing operations analysts to work in logistics, procurement, and quality assurance.
  • Cross-training sessions for finance team members to learn both AP and AR functions for better workload coverage.
  • A mentorship-based cross-functional exposure track for high-potential employees to shadow product managers and engineers.

Related content: Read our guide to virtual training

 

Modern Approaches to Employee Training

 

Microlearning and Just-in-Time Training

Microlearning breaks down complex topics into small, digestible lessons that are easy to access and retain. These bite-sized modules (delivered through videos, quizzes, infographics, or interactive slides) can be completed in minutes, making them useful for busy employees or as reinforcement after formal training. They support spaced repetition, which improves long-term memory and skill recall over time.

Just-in-time training complements this by delivering information precisely when employees need it. For example, a technician troubleshooting a device might access a short video on a mobile app showing the fix, rather than sitting through a full training course beforehand. These tools boost productivity by reducing downtime and help employees apply knowledge in real-world situations without delay.

 

Blended and Hybrid Learning Models

Blended learning combines the convenience of digital content with the depth of in-person sessions. Employees complete foundational topics online at their own pace and then participate in live workshops to practice skills, ask questions, or engage in group activities. This structure is particularly effective for technical or compliance training that requires both theoretical and hands-on components.

Hybrid learning builds on this by adding flexibility in how employees attend sessions, either in person or virtually. Live sessions may be recorded for those who can’t attend in real time, increasing access across different locations and schedules. These models enable companies to deliver consistent training at scale without sacrificing human interaction or engagement.

 

Gamification and Simulation-Based Learning

Gamification increases engagement by turning training into an interactive experience. Employees earn points, unlock achievements, or appear on leaderboards as they complete lessons or challenges. These game elements tap into intrinsic motivation, especially when tied to recognition or friendly competition, helping learners stay focused and return for more.

Simulation-based learning, on the other hand, immerses employees in realistic environments where they can practice decision-making, technical skills, or customer interactions. This method is especially useful in high-stakes roles like healthcare, finance, or aviation, where mistakes in the real world carry significant consequences. Simulations provide a safe space to fail, learn, and improve before applying skills on the job.

 

Social and Collaborative Learning

Social learning encourages employees to share expertise, exchange feedback, and solve problems together. This can happen through informal channels like chat groups or structured formats like peer learning circles and knowledge-sharing sessions. It taps into collective experience and makes learning feel more relevant and immediate.

Collaborative learning builds on this by incorporating team-based activities into training, such as group projects, joint problem-solving tasks, or internal forums where employees discuss course topics. These methods not only build skills but also promote trust, communication, and a stronger learning culture across departments and roles.

 

AI-Powered Personalized Learning Paths

AI-driven training systems tailor learning experiences to each employee’s needs by analyzing job roles, past performance, completed training, and skill gaps. Based on this data, the system suggests specific modules, adjusts content difficulty, and highlights areas for improvement. This level of personalization reduces time spent on irrelevant material and keeps training focused.

Over time, these systems adapt as employees progress, offering increasingly advanced or related content to support continuous development. Managers can also use AI-generated insights to monitor team skills and plan workforce development more strategically. Personalized learning paths help ensure that both organizational goals and individual growth stay aligned.

 

How to Build an Effective Employee Training Program 

 

Conducting Training Needs Analysis

Before building a training program, it’s essential to understand where skill gaps exist and why they matter. A well-executed training needs analysis ensures resources are spent where they’ll have the most impact, aligned with both current performance issues and future business goals.

  • Analyze job descriptions to identify required skills and compare them with current employee capabilities
  • Review performance metrics (e.g., error rates, productivity levels, customer feedback) to spot areas needing improvement
  • Survey employees and managers to gather insights on perceived skill gaps and development priorities
  • Conduct one-on-one interviews with team leads or department heads to validate training needs
  • Use skills assessments or tests to objectively measure current knowledge and competencies
  • Identify upcoming changes (e.g., new systems, regulations, or strategies) that will require new capabilities
  • Map competencies to roles to determine training priorities by function or job level

 

Setting Clear and Measurable Learning Objectives

Effective training starts with knowing exactly what you want learners to achieve. Well-defined learning objectives help guide content development, keep training focused, and make it easier to evaluate success.

  • Use the SMART framework to define objectives that are specific, measurable, achievable, relevant, and time-bound
  • Focus on observable actions (e.g., “complete a sales call using the new script”) rather than vague outcomes (“understand the sales script”)
  • Align objectives with business goals to ensure training drives organizational outcomes
  • Tailor objectives to different employee roles or experience levels
  • Include success criteria that allow for post-training evaluation
  • Validate objectives with stakeholders to ensure they’re relevant and realistic
  • Use objectives to shape assessments and content structure during training design

 

Utilize LMS, AI Tools, and Video Learning Platforms

Technology plays a critical role in scaling and managing employee training. Combining LMS platforms with AI and video learning tools allows organizations to deliver personalized, flexible, and trackable learning experiences.

  • Use an LMS to assign, schedule, and track courses centrally
  • Enable employees to access self-paced courses anytime, anywhere
  • Integrate AI to recommend learning paths based on role, skill gaps, or past performance
  • Use data analytics in the LMS to monitor engagement and completion rates
  • Offer video-based learning to support remote and visual learners
  • Embed quizzes or knowledge checks into video content for active engagement
  • Leverage mobile-compatible tools so training can happen on the go

 

Developing Engaging Training Content

To capture attention and promote retention, training content must be both relevant and adaptable. Video-based learning and AI-driven personalization are particularly effective for delivering engaging and scalable content.

  • Create short, focused video modules that demonstrate real tasks or procedures
  • Use animations or screen recordings to explain software or complex processes
  • Include interactive elements like quizzes or decision-based scenarios to keep learners involved
  • Use AI to dynamically adapt content difficulty based on learner responses or prior knowledge
  • Tailor content to specific roles or departments to ensure relevance
  • Build branching video paths that let learners explore based on their job context
  • Regularly update content to reflect changing tools, policies, or best practices

 

Measuring Training Effectiveness and ROI

Without measurement, there’s no way to know if training worked. Evaluating both learning outcomes and business results helps justify investment and guide improvements.

  • Conduct pre- and post-training assessments to measure knowledge gain
  • Use on-the-job evaluations to see if employees are applying new skills
  • Distribute surveys to collect feedback on training relevance and delivery
  • Track metrics like productivity, error rates, or customer satisfaction before and after training
  • Compare training costs to benefits like improved performance or reduced turnover
  • Monitor course completion rates and engagement metrics through your LMS
  • Use dashboards or scorecards to report ROI to stakeholders and inform future decisions

 

Related content: Read our guide to webinars tools for online teaching (coming soon)

 

Empowering Employee Training Programs with Kaltura

 

Kaltura’s Training Platform makes it easy for organizations to build dynamic, branded employee training programs that drive real engagement and retention. From onboarding to leadership development, teams can create video-based learning sessions in minutes—no IT or design skills required. With ready-to-use templates, HR and L&D teams can design training sessions that reflect company culture and deliver a consistent learning experience across departments and regions.

Kaltura Training Platform brings training sessions to life with interactive tools like polls, quizzes, whiteboards, and breakout rooms that keep learners actively involved. Employees can join live sessions or watch on-demand recordings later, ensuring no one misses out—no matter their location or schedule. These flexible learning formats make it easier to support hybrid and global workforces while improving knowledge retention.

Kaltura AI capabilities (as part of Kaltura’s AI solution Work Genie) takes learning a step further by transforming company knowledge into on-demand, query-based answers. Employees can ask questions and instantly receive concise, accurate responses—delivered as short video clips, flashcards, or interactive summaries. By securely drawing on your organization’s internal data and archives, Genie keeps all information in-house for full compliance while turning static training materials into a living knowledge system that supports continuous learning and faster skill development.

Kaltura’s secure, enterprise-grade video technology ensures every session runs smoothly and meets the highest compliance standards. Trainers can easily upload multimedia resources, prepare playlists, and moderate discussions, while built-in analytics provide detailed insights into attendance, engagement, and learning outcomes. With these data-driven metrics, organizations can continuously optimize their employee training programs for maximum impact and ROI.

By bringing everything together in one platform—live and on-demand training, collaboration tools, branded experiences, and real-time analytics—Kaltura empowers companies to upskill and reskill their workforce at scale. It’s the complete solution for creating modern, interactive learning experiences that truly elevate employee development.

 

Follow Us